CARBON CRUCIBLE AND METHOD FOR PRODUCING SILICON SINGLE CRYSTAL BY USING CARBON CRUCIBLE

机译:碳坩埚及使用碳坩埚生产硅单晶的方法

摘要

PROBLEM TO BE SOLVED: To provide a carbon crucible which is used for supporting and holding a quartz glass crucible for accommodating a molten material in a device for producing single crystals or poly-crystals such as a semiconductor material or a solar cell material, and which supports the quartz glass crucible to deter the deformation and easily detaches the quartz glass crucible after refrigeration.;SOLUTION: The carbon crucible 1 includes a counter part 2 for constituting a crucible bottom and a cylindrical body 3 superimposed on or inserted into the counter part 2. The counter part 2 comprises a graphite material. The cylindrical body 3 comprises a carbon fiber-reinforced-carbon-combined material formed by laminating a carbon fiber fabric cloth 4. A discontinuous part F is installed from a one end part to the other one end part of the cylindrical body 3. In the discontinuous part F, a carbon fiber-reinforced-combined material is present on at least one part of a direction vertical to the axis line of the cylindrical body 3.The carbon crucible has a structure of demonstrating binding force in the circumferential direction of the cylindrical body 3.;COPYRIGHT: (C)2012,JPO&INPIT
